## Step 2: Set up the Thimbleshot CLI

Welcome aboard! Thimbleshot handles all our batch image resizing, so you'll run it constantly. Install it from the internal registry, then point it at the shared asset bucket. It picks up sizes from a profile file rather than flags. Your local profile should contain the following configuration values:

service settings:
[casax]
port = 6379
team = rusir
host = casax.zemvarhq.corp
region = outer-4
access_code = ac_9808ce
timeout_ms = 1500

**Ticket PARITY-412: Kestrel SDK catch-up**

Quick one for the weekly sync: the Kestrel-Go SDK is still missing batched uploads and retry hints that Kestrel-JS shipped two releases ago. Partner teams keep asking. Plan is to land both behind a flag this sprint and cut a minor release. Needs a sign-off from the owner named below.

account owner for bajef-badup: Drueth Kelath Pelael Holwyn

Purchase price indication is 6.2x trailing earnings, funded through existing facilities and a modest bridge. Diligence found stable margins but ageing equipment at the Harwick site, implying roughly two years of catch-up capital spend. Synergies in distribution look achievable; procurement savings less certain. Leonor Vask recommends proceeding to a binding offer subject to a price adjustment. The confidential note below records the agreed plan.

confidential, kagup-bafog: Fraaxax Group is in early talks to buy Soroxox Group for about $343.8 million. The Olidor launch date is June 14, and nothing goes to the press before then. Legal wants the Aldmirek Logistics term sheet signed before July 23.

**Ticket DRIFT-412: SQL lint rules out of sync on Parsley staging**

Priority: medium. Staging runners for Parsley are using an older ruleset than prod — lowercase keywords pass there, fail in prod CI. Root cause: someone hand-edited the staging linter config in March and never committed it. Do not copy staging's file anywhere. Revert staging to the canonical ruleset, rerun the lint suite on the `reporting` schemas, and confirm zero new violations. The canonical configuration is as follows.

deployment values, yadug-bawif:
[framir]
team = pelox
access_code = ac_a38ab2
owner = tamion.julael
host = framir.tolvaqlabs.test
port = 11211
peer = tammir.zemvargrid.local
salt = 2215ef03
pin = 1541